mirror of
				https://github.com/inventree/InvenTree.git
				synced 2025-10-26 02:47:41 +00:00 
			
		
		
		
	Merge remote-tracking branch 'inventree/master' into drf-api-forms
# Conflicts: # InvenTree/company/forms.py
This commit is contained in:
		
							
								
								
									
										25
									
								
								InvenTree/stock/migrations/0065_auto_20210701_0509.py
									
									
									
									
									
										Normal file
									
								
							
							
						
						
									
										25
									
								
								InvenTree/stock/migrations/0065_auto_20210701_0509.py
									
									
									
									
									
										Normal file
									
								
							| @@ -0,0 +1,25 @@ | ||||
| # Generated by Django 3.2.4 on 2021-07-01 05:09 | ||||
|  | ||||
| import InvenTree.fields | ||||
| from django.db import migrations | ||||
| import djmoney.models.fields | ||||
|  | ||||
|  | ||||
| class Migration(migrations.Migration): | ||||
|  | ||||
|     dependencies = [ | ||||
|         ('stock', '0064_auto_20210621_1724'), | ||||
|     ] | ||||
|  | ||||
|     operations = [ | ||||
|         migrations.AlterField( | ||||
|             model_name='stockitem', | ||||
|             name='purchase_price', | ||||
|             field=InvenTree.fields.InvenTreeModelMoneyField(blank=True, currency_choices=[], decimal_places=4, default_currency='', help_text='Single unit purchase price at time of purchase', max_digits=19, null=True, verbose_name='Purchase Price'), | ||||
|         ), | ||||
|         migrations.AlterField( | ||||
|             model_name='stockitem', | ||||
|             name='purchase_price_currency', | ||||
|             field=djmoney.models.fields.CurrencyField(choices=[], default='', editable=False, max_length=3), | ||||
|         ), | ||||
|     ] | ||||
| @@ -20,14 +20,10 @@ from django.contrib.auth.models import User | ||||
| from django.db.models.signals import pre_delete | ||||
| from django.dispatch import receiver | ||||
|  | ||||
| from common.settings import currency_code_default | ||||
|  | ||||
| from markdownx.models import MarkdownxField | ||||
|  | ||||
| from mptt.models import MPTTModel, TreeForeignKey | ||||
|  | ||||
| from djmoney.models.fields import MoneyField | ||||
|  | ||||
| from decimal import Decimal, InvalidOperation | ||||
| from datetime import datetime, timedelta | ||||
| from InvenTree import helpers | ||||
| @@ -38,7 +34,7 @@ import label.models | ||||
|  | ||||
| from InvenTree.status_codes import StockStatus, StockHistoryCode | ||||
| from InvenTree.models import InvenTreeTree, InvenTreeAttachment | ||||
| from InvenTree.fields import InvenTreeURLField | ||||
| from InvenTree.fields import InvenTreeModelMoneyField, InvenTreeURLField | ||||
|  | ||||
| from users.models import Owner | ||||
|  | ||||
| @@ -541,10 +537,9 @@ class StockItem(MPTTModel): | ||||
|         help_text=_('Stock Item Notes') | ||||
|     ) | ||||
|  | ||||
|     purchase_price = MoneyField( | ||||
|     purchase_price = InvenTreeModelMoneyField( | ||||
|         max_digits=19, | ||||
|         decimal_places=4, | ||||
|         default_currency=currency_code_default(), | ||||
|         blank=True, | ||||
|         null=True, | ||||
|         verbose_name=_('Purchase Price'), | ||||
|   | ||||
		Reference in New Issue
	
	Block a user